Kinds Of French Doors
French doors can be found in various styles to meet different preferences and practical requirements. Here, we explore the most popular types:
4.1 Traditional French Doors
Conventional French doors are defined by their traditional style, featuring numerous small glass panes divided by a grid pattern called "muntins." They are typically made of wood and can be personalized with different surfaces, supplying a lovely look matched for vintage or classic home styles.
4.2 Sliding French Doors
Sliding French doors operate by gliding along a track rather than swinging open. This style is perfect for smaller areas where traditional hinges might impede motion. They often include big glass panels, taking full advantage of natural light consumption in addition to offering extensive outdoor views.
4.3 Bi-Fold French Doors
Bi-fold French doors include a number of panels that fold and slide against each other, developing a wide opening suited for patios and garden spaces. This design is incredibly popular for modern homes, efficiently combining indoor and outdoor living locations.
4.4 Single French Doors
Single French doors consist of a single panel and are perfect for smaller sized entrances, like a research study or a nook. While they maintain the beauty of standard French doors, they need less space and can fit different architectural styles.

Materials Used
French doors can be built from different products, each offering distinct attributes, advantages, and aesthetics:
Material TypeDescriptionProsConsWoodTimeless option, using heat and charmNatural aesthetic, adjustableRequires upkeepVinylLong lasting and low-maintenanceEnergy-efficient, budget friendlyLimited color choicesFiberglassSimulates wood but uses remarkable insulationWeather-resistant, flexibleHigher initial costAluminumKnown for strength and durabilityMinimal maintenanceCan perform heat, less insulation6.
